It's latke time
It's latke time
In Leslie's family it is traditional to eat latkes (Yiddish for little potato pancakes) at this time of year. They are fried in a lot of oil and salted generously. Her mom's latkes were wonderful but they couldn't have been good for you. She wonders if our present day focus on healthier foods has produced recipes that are better for you than her mom's method was.
